About Me:
Musician, tabwrdd player in Dr Price's Fire Band (the twmpath/ceildh band), deputy editor working for Taplas, the all-Wales folk magazine. Ex-chief sub-editor on the South Wales Echo. I am currently recording at least 400 songs in my collection (known as The South Wales Song Archive) in St Fagans Museum Of Welsh Life, in a collaboration with collector and singer Dafydd Idris Edwards and trac, the Wales folk development organisation. I estimate that it will take about a year.
